Output 1ecd6263331eeeb70a2b8c4420d0a86bbaf65f3eff6262b918e423eb19d4f4a0:0

value
105692838
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7f7e5519c764867fe3de425577b77284bdb90f82 OP_EQUAL
address
3DK95dtzhZEKB5APF2AjxAuSVvEVSsf9h1
transaction
1ecd6263331eeeb70a2b8c4420d0a86bbaf65f3eff6262b918e423eb19d4f4a0
spent
true